реклама на сайте
подробности

 
 
> банальный вопрос, двунаправленные порты
skilful
сообщение May 27 2007, 23:51
Сообщение #1


Частый гость
**

Группа: Свой
Сообщений: 186
Регистрация: 23-04-06
Из: Сочи
Пользователь №: 16 411



Всем привет! smile.gif Имеется код описания устройства с INOUT в МАХ+. Как его только промоделировать не знаю. В симуляторе не устанавливается нужное значение на выходе, а устанавливается "Х". Можно ли промоделировать его, без тестбенча, а только используя редактор в симуляторе

Код
LIBRARY IEEE;
USE IEEE.std_logic_1164.all;

ENTITY env IS
PORT ( OE : in std_logic;
      Data_in_out : inout std_logic_vector(2 downto 0);
          Data_in : in std_logic_vector(2 downto 0);
         data_out : out std_logic_vector(2 downto 0));
END env;

ARCHITECTURE work OF env IS

SIGNAL data: std_logic_vector(2 downto 0);

BEGIN
   data_out <= data_in_out when OE = '0';

   data_in_out <= Data_in when OE = '1' else (others=>'Z');
END env;









+ еще такой вопрос. При таком коде синезируется такой вот пин???
Эскизы прикрепленных изображений
Прикрепленное изображение
 
Go to the top of the page
 
+Quote Post



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 18th July 2025 - 21:48
Рейтинг@Mail.ru


Страница сгенерированна за 0.0142 секунд с 7
ELECTRONIX ©2004-2016